At their core, CAD maps are digital technical drawings used to visualize physical spaces with high accuracy. They are predominantly used by engineers, surveyors, and architects to design everything from individual building interiors to complex underground utility networks. Key Characteristics

While often mentioned together, CAD and (GIS) serve different purposes. CAD is primarily a digital drawing format focusing on precise shapes, whereas GIS is an analytical system that adds semantic meaning and database-driven attributes to geographic data. The Conversion Challenge
